site stats

Clustering type k-means

WebThe k-means algorithm determines a set of k clusters and assignes each Examples to exact one cluster. The clusters consist of similar Examples. The similarity between Examples is based on a distance measure between them. WebNov 24, 2024 · The following stages will help us understand how the K-Means clustering technique works-. Step 1: First, we need to provide the number of clusters, K, that need to be generated by this algorithm. Step 2: Next, choose K data points at random and assign each to a cluster. Briefly, categorize the data based on the number of data points.

Clustering in Machine Learning - GeeksforGeeks

WebApr 10, 2024 · K-means clustering assigns each data point to the closest cluster centre, then iteratively updates the cluster centres to minimise the distance between data points and their assigned clusters. WebJan 20, 2024 · K Means Clustering Using the Elbow Method In the Elbow method, we are actually varying the number of clusters (K) from 1 – 10. For each value of K, we are calculating WCSS (Within-Cluster Sum of Square). WCSS is the sum of the squared distance between each point and the centroid in a cluster. malisia script font free https://ciiembroidery.com

CS221 - Stanford University

WebApr 1, 2024 · Clustering reveals the following three groups, indicated by different colors: Figure 2: Sample data after clustering. Clustering is divided into two subgroups based on the assignment of data points to clusters: Hard: Each data point is assigned to exactly one cluster. One example is k-means clustering. WebThe K-means clustering algorithm on Airbnb rentals in NYC. You may need to increase the max_iter for a large number of clusters or n_init for a complex dataset. Ordinarily though the only parameter you'll need to choose yourself is n_clusters (k, that is). The best partitioning for a set of features depends on the model you're using and what ... WebSep 12, 2024 · Step 3: Use Scikit-Learn. We’ll use some of the available functions in the Scikit-learn library to process the randomly generated data.. Here is the code: from sklearn.cluster import KMeans Kmean = … malisia font free download

How I used sklearn’s Kmeans to cluster the Iris dataset

Category:How to Visualize the Clusters in a K-Means Unsupervised ... - dummies

Tags:Clustering type k-means

Clustering type k-means

Understanding K-means Clustering in Machine Learning

WebK-Means algorithm is one of the most used clustering algorithm for Knowledge Discovery in Data Mining. Seed based K-Means is the integration of a small set of labeled data (called seeds) to the K-Means algorithm to improve its performances and overcome its sensitivity to initial centers. These centers are, most of the time, generated at random or they are … WebMar 27, 2024 · Cluster documents in multiple categories based on tags, topics, and the content of the document. this is a very standard classification problem and k-means is a highly suitable algorithm for this ...

Clustering type k-means

Did you know?

WebFeb 16, 2024 · K-Means clustering is one of the unsupervised algorithms where the available input data does not have a labeled response. Types of Clustering. Clustering is a type of unsupervised learning wherein data … WebSep 25, 2024 · In Order to find the centre , this is what we do. 1. Get the x co-ordinates of all the black points and take mean for that and let’s say it is x_mean. 2. Do the same for the y co-ordinates of ...

WebNov 3, 2024 · K-Means++: This is the default method for initializing clusters. The K-means++ algorithm was proposed in 2007 by David Arthur and Sergei Vassilvitskii to … k-means clustering is a method of vector quantization, originally from signal processing, that aims to partition n observations into k clusters in which each observation belongs to the cluster with the nearest mean (cluster centers or cluster centroid), serving as a prototype of the cluster. This results in a … See more The term "k-means" was first used by James MacQueen in 1967, though the idea goes back to Hugo Steinhaus in 1956. The standard algorithm was first proposed by Stuart Lloyd of Bell Labs in 1957 as a technique for See more Three key features of k-means that make it efficient are often regarded as its biggest drawbacks: • Euclidean distance is used as a metric and variance is used as a measure of cluster scatter. • The number of clusters k is an input parameter: an … See more Gaussian mixture model The slow "standard algorithm" for k-means clustering, and its associated expectation-maximization algorithm, is a special case of a Gaussian … See more Different implementations of the algorithm exhibit performance differences, with the fastest on a test data set finishing in 10 seconds, the … See more Standard algorithm (naive k-means) The most common algorithm uses an iterative refinement technique. Due to its ubiquity, it is often called "the k-means algorithm"; it is also referred to as Lloyd's algorithm, particularly in the computer science community. … See more k-means clustering is rather easy to apply to even large data sets, particularly when using heuristics such as Lloyd's algorithm. It has been … See more The set of squared error minimizing cluster functions also includes the k-medoids algorithm, an approach which forces the center point of each cluster to be one of the actual points, … See more

WebMar 26, 2016 · Compare the K-means clustering output to the original scatter plot — which provides labels because the outcomes are known. You can see that the two plots resemble each other. The K-means algorithm did a pretty good job with the clustering. Although the predictions aren’t perfect, they come close. That’s a win for the algorithm. WebApr 9, 2024 · K-Means++ was developed to reduce the sensitivity of a traditional K-Means clustering algorithm, by choosing the next clustering center with probability inversely proportional to the distance from the current clustering center. Then we verified the validity of the six subcategories we defined by inertia and silhouette score and evaluated the ...

WebJun 22, 2024 · The k-Modes is a clustering method based on partitioning. Its algorithm is an improvement form of the k-Means for categorical data type

WebCell type identification is a key step in the research of disease mechanisms. Many clustering algorithms have been proposed to identify cell types. ... that combines the low-rank representation approach with K-means clustering. The cluster centroid is updated as the cell dimension decreases to better from new clusters and improve the quality of ... malisic webshopWebNov 3, 2016 · The k-Means clustering algorithm is a popular algorithm that falls into this category. In these models, the no. of cluster parameters required at the end has to be mentioned beforehand, which makes it … malisic export importWebJul 18, 2024 · k-means requires you to decide the number of clusters k beforehand. How do you determine the optimal value of k? Try running the algorithm for increasing k and note the sum of cluster... malisic mpWebApr 12, 2024 · Where V max is the maximum surface wind speed in m/s for every 6-hour interval during the TC duration (T), dt is the time step in s, the unit of PDI is m 3 /s 2, and the value of PDI is multiplied by 10 − 11 for the convenience of plotting. (b) Clustering methodology. In this study, the K-means clustering method of Nakamura et al. was … malisic shopWebDec 6, 2016 · K-means clustering is a type of unsupervised learning, which is used when you have unlabeled data (i.e., data without defined categories or groups). The goal of … malisic tromeđaWebIn image compression, K-means is used to cluster pixels of an image that reduce the overall size of it. It is also used in document clustering to find relevant documents in one … malisiscore anyWebK-means # K-means is a commonly-used clustering algorithm. It groups given data points into a predefined number of clusters. Input Columns # Param name Type Default Description featuresCol Vector "features" Feature vector. Output Columns # Param name Type Default Description predictionCol Integer "prediction" Predicted cluster center. … malish wire brush